Machine Learning Engr

2 days ago


Bengaluru, India Synopsys Full time

39693BR
- INDIA - Bangalore

**Job Description and Requirements**

**Software Engineer - Artificial Intelligence**

The AI team is responsible for designing and developing the next generation Machine Learning and AI / Cloud architecture for our tools. Towards this end, we are looking for a software engineer with expertise in microservices architecture, containers, distributed systems, webservers fine-tuning, and API design who can help develop and deploy robust software components that meet our high-quality requirements both on-prem and in public cloud.

**Responsibilities**
- This role may span multiple tiers such as data management, backend services, visualization, and presentation, as well as APIs for the infrastructure.
- The Software Engineer is expected to exercise judgment in selecting methods and techniques to obtain solutions, and work on problems of diverse scope where analysis of situations or data requires evaluation of various factors.
- Can perform with little or no instructions on day-to-day work, and with occasional general instructions on new assignments and projects. Is able to work both independently and collaboratively. Provides regular updates to manager on project status.

**Requirements**:

- BS/MS EE/CS/CE with a minimum of 3+ years of experience developing large scale architectures and distributed systems
- Experience in microservices architecture based design and implementation
- Hands-on experience in one or more languages such as C/C++, Python, Java, JavaScript, XML, UML, JSON
- Experience with containerization, distributed computing, fault tolerance, throughput and latency tuning, CI/CD pipelines
- Experience in datastores (one or more of SQL, No-SQL, S3 object stores, columnar, time series, in memory, etc)
- Strong background in file systems, data structures, algorithms, performance, and scalability. Demonstrates good analysis and problem-solving skills
- Ability to work independently, and exceptional verbal/written communication, leadership, interpersonal, and teamwork skills are a must

**Desired skills**
- Experience in working in Data Engineering tools such as Kafka, Spark, Hive, HDFS, Airflow, MLFlow, Kubeflow, ActiveMQ, Prometheus, Grafana, Kibana, GUI Technologies (Angular, React, GWT)
- Experience in API design, security, Identity & Access Management
- Experience in working (configuring, deploying, managing, and monitoring) with AWS, GCP, and/or Microsoft Azure, experience with Terraform and/or Cloud Formation
- Experience in machine learning and deep learning, ML model versioning and deployment.
- Cloud certifications are a plus: AWS Solutions Architect, Cloud Security Certification, OpenStack Certification
- Solid understanding of storage platforms and leading technology vendors

Our Silicon Design & Verification business is all about building high-performance silicon chips—faster. We’re the world’s leading provider of solutions for designing and verifying advanced silicon chips. And we design the next-generation processes and models needed to manufacture those chips. We enable our customers to optimize chips for power, cost, and performance—eliminating months off their project schedules.

**At Synopsys, we’re at the heart of the innovations that change the way we work and play. Self-driving cars. Artificial Intelligence. The cloud. 5G. The Internet of Things. These breakthroughs are ushering in the Era of Smart Everything. And we’re powering it all with the world’s most advanced technologies for chip design and software security. If you share our passion for innovation, we want to meet you.**
- Inclusion and Diversity are important to us. Synopsys considers all applicants for employment without regard to race, color, religion, national origin, gender, sexual orientation, gender identity, age, military veteran status, or disability._

**Job Category**
- Engineering

**Country**
- India

**Job Subcategory**
- Machine Learning

**Hire Type**
- Employee



  • Bengaluru, India Synopsys Full time

    46996BR - INDIA - Bangalore, INDIA - Hyderabad **Job Description and Requirements** **Job Description and Requirements**: - We are searching for an experienced, passionate, and self-driven individual who possesses both a broad technical strategy and the ability to tackle architectural and modernization challenges. - As a Principal Engineer you will be...

  • Operational Engr Ii

    1 week ago


    Bengaluru, Karnataka, India CSG Full time

    Hi, I'm Recruiter Minnie J , your Recruiter and guide to joining CSG! We are excited to learn more about you and your unique background. At CSG, we choose to see beyond a resume paper. We put your story, perspective, background, and what you have to offer first. While the traditional approach works for some, many miss out on fantastic talent like...

  • Machine Learning

    1 week ago


    Bengaluru, India Thompsons HR Consulting Full time

    **Experience**: 2-6 years as a Machine Learning Engineer or similar role **Required Skills**: - Understanding of data structures, data modeling and software architecture - Deep knowledge of math, probability, statistics and algorithms - Ability to write robust code in Python, Java and R - Familiarity with machine learning frameworks (like Keras or PyTorch)...


  • Bengaluru, Karnataka, India Maneva Consulting Private Limited Full time

    Job DescriptionGreetings from ManevaJob DescriptionJob Title-Machine Learning MachineExperience-5 -15 daysLocation-Bangalore (Kodathi, 5 days WFO)Notice-Immediate to 60 daysRequirements:-Education: Bachelor's or Master's degree in Computer Science, Machine Learning, Data Science, Electrical Engineering, or a related quantitative field.Experience: 5+ years of...


  • Bengaluru, Karnataka, India Spydra Full time

    Job DescriptionJob Summary:We are seeking a talented and motivated Machine Learning Engineer to join our team. The ideal candidate will have a strong background in machine learning algorithms, data analysis, and software development. You will be responsible for designing, developing, and deploying machine learning models and systems that drive our products...


  • Bengaluru, Karnataka, India beBeeMachineLearning Full time ₹ 1,50,00,000 - ₹ 2,50,00,000

    Job Title: Machine Learning ExpertWe are seeking a skilled machine learning expert to join our team. This individual will be responsible for designing and developing advanced machine learning models to solve complex problems.">Key Responsibilities:Design and develop predictive analytics solutions using machine learning algorithms.Build and deploy deep...


  • Bengaluru, Karnataka, India beBeeMachineLearning Full time ₹ 15,70,000 - ₹ 25,15,000

    Job Title: Machine Learning EngineerWe are seeking an experienced Machine Learning Engineer to join our team. As a Machine Learning Engineer, you will be responsible for designing, developing, and deploying machine learning models that can solve complex business problems.Responsibilities:Design and develop machine learning models using linear regression,...


  • Bengaluru, India GARUDAIRE PRIVATE LIMITED Full time

    Job Summary: Key Responsibilities: Design and develop training programs to teach staff members the latest machine learning techniques, tools, and algorithms using PyTorch. Conduct research to develop new models to meet business requirements. Collaborate with cross-functional teams to develop machine learning solutions that support business goals. Provide...


  • Bengaluru, Karnataka, India beBeeMachineLearning Full time ₹ 15,00,000 - ₹ 20,00,000

    Job OpportunityWe are seeking a highly skilled and experienced Machine Learning Engineer to join our dynamic team. This is an exceptional opportunity for individuals with a strong background in machine learning algorithms, programming, and data analysis.Key Responsibilities:Collaborate with cross-functional teams to define and understand business problems...


  • Bengaluru, Karnataka, India beBeeData Full time ₹ 1,00,00,000 - ₹ 2,00,00,000

    Machine Learning Engineering Opportunity About the Role:We are seeking an experienced Machine Learning Engineer to join our team. As a key member of our engineering organization, you will be responsible for designing and implementing scalable machine learning workflows using frameworks like TensorFlow, PyTorch, and Scikit-learn. Key Responsibilities:Design...